Parliamentarian Julius Malema, head of the pan-Africanist Marxist party Economic Freedom Fighters in South Africa, has endorsed decriminalizing sex work at a Women’s Day rally, linking this move to a broader agenda of protecting women from violence. Whether this will provide new impetus to the long-stalled bill proposed by the South African cabinet in 2022 remains to be seen. In the meantime several civil society groups, including the Sex Workers Education & Advocacy Taskforce (SWEAT), have resorted to action in the courts to challenge the existing law.
